LOWER ALLEN TOWNSHIP, Pa.–Several roads were shut down Friday afternoon after a major gas leak was detected in Cumberland County.

The gas leak occurred shortly after 12:30 p.m. at Cedar Avenue and St. John’s Road in Lower Allen Township. Authorities said a contractor working in the area accidentally struck a gas line.

A two block radius was evacuated. By 2 p.m. most of the people who were evacuated were allowed to return to their homes.

Currently, Cedar Avenue and St John’s Road remain closed. All other road are back open.

Power has been restored to the area and the leak has been stopped.
